Job DescriptionJob DescriptionWhy WHIN?WHIN Music Community Charter School is the first school of its kind! Built on the principles of El Sistema, WHIN is a place where children learn, grow, and make music together. At WHIN, we are building a nucleo, a community where staff, families, and students work together to make a powerful shift in public education that puts learners’ needs first.Our Mission:To provide our diverse student population with rigorous academic instruction, intensive music education and a positive learning environment so that every student can thrive academically and personally. We believe…that all children deserve a high quality education, with access to academic rigor, music creation, and a holistic approach to developing character.that a collaboration with families ensures the greatest success for our learners.that restorative justice, inquiry-based hands on learning, and authentic learning experiences provide the most effective environments for growth, success, and joy.We are looking for staff who are…looking to grow and prosper in a collaborative work environmentexcited about working in a school and neighborhood where diversity is centralinterested in learning about being an educatorIn action, our mission looks like caring deeply about all aspects of our young learners’ potential. We make academics a priority while also ensuring students’ character and personal growth. With music at its core, students experience working together to create something bigger than their individual skills every single day, and this approach extends to our classrooms where project-based, hands-on learning cultivates curious, creative, and hardworking learners.  Specifically, English as a New Language (ENL)  teachers at WHIN are responsible for:Creating and maintaining a fun, engaging, and inclusive classroom culture where all students love to learnProviding integrated instruction in an inclusive classroom with all learnersDeveloping and implementing high quality lesson plans accessible to all learners needs Assessing students ELL status on ATS, administering home language surveys, and conducting NYSITELL and NYSESLAT assessments when neededDriving academic outcomes for all students by analyzing data, differentiating instruction, and supporting each learner’s unique needsCollaborating with colleagues to implement an effective integrated co-teaching model to serve all students in an inclusive classroomSupporting colleagues in their understanding and work with ENL studentsInspiring students and fellow staff to perform at his or her highest potentialDeveloping and maintaining strong and professional relationships with WHIN families Qualifications:NYS or equivalent ELL, TESOL, or ESL Teaching CertificationBilingual (Fluent in Spanish and English minimum)Urban elementary teaching experienceDemonstrated success raising achievement levels of all studentsAn unwavering belief that all students can achieve at a high levelProven commitment and success working with students and familiesThe ability to thrive in a startup environmentThe ability to excel in a fast-paced, dynamic, and exciting schoolA sense of humor and kindness towards your colleagues Advanced proficiency in one or more of the following areas is strongly preferredBilingual (Spanish)Music performanceEarly Childhood teaching experience and/or certificationsProject Based Learning and Inquiry Based LearningResponsive Classroom, Love & Logic Student Management, and Restorative Justice modelsCompensation and Benefits: WHIN offers a competitive salary, determined through an equity-focused approach that considers an individual’s skills, education, and relevant experience.
